Frequently Asked Questions about St. Paul
How much are Studio apartments in St. Paul?
There are currently 1,059 Studio Apartments in St. Paul with rent ranges from $629 to $2,393 with an average price of $1,243.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om St. Paul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in St. Paul ranges from $789 to $3,577 with an average monthly rent of $1,492.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in St. Paul c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in St. Paul range from $469 to $5,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,778.
How expensive are St. Paul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 272 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in St. Paul on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$739 to $5,930 - averaging $2,157 for the location.
